Furry Nails

Furry nails are coming back in the limelight. Although its mixed reviews, it did gain some popularity due to its unique use of texture. The first trend of furry nails started in 2016 when Jan Arnold, co-founder and creative director of CND (Creative Nail Design), debuted them at the Libertine Fall/Winter 2016 fashion show during New York Fashion Week. The look featured faux fur glued onto nails, creating a bold and eccentric statement that sparked viral attention in the beauty world.

What are furry nails?

Furry nails meaning refer to a nail art trend where faux fur pieces or flocking powder are used to create a fuzzy texture on nails. These textured manicures can be achieved by gluing faux fur onto the nail bed or by using a flocking powder technique.

Similar to furry nails are fuzzy nails or fluffy nails that are achieved by spreading a substance called flocking powder onto a wet nail paint coat. This technique provides a velvety look with a softer, more practical feel. Nail artists often experiment with various flocking powder colors, glittery textures, and multicolored designs to make each set unique.

Do Furry Nails Smell?

Furry nails may absorb odors if exposed to dirt or moisture, so keeping them clean and dry is essential.

Fuzzy nails with flocking powder generally don’t smell since the powder is clean and doesn’t trap odors. Flocking powder is also water-resistant and easier to maintain compared to faux fur. Proper care helps both types stay fresh.

Care Tips for Furry and Fuzzy Nails

  • Avoid Water Exposure: Keep nails dry to prevent odor and damage.
  • Gentle Cleaning: Use a soft brush to remove dirt; avoid harsh scrubbing.
  • Faux Fur Care: Lightly wipe with a damp cloth if necessary; let it air dry.
  • Flocking Powder Nails: Require less maintenance due to water resistance.
